def show_new_screen(self, instance_new_screen, string_new_name_screen):
"""????????????? ????? ?????."""
# ???? ???????? ??????? ???? ? ??? ?? ?????, ????????, About ? About.
name_current_screen = self.start_screen.screen_manager.current
if name_current_screen == string_new_name_screen:
return
# ??????? ????? ????? (Activity).
screen = Screen(name=string_new_name_screen)
screen.add_widget(instance_new_screen)
# ????????? Activity ? ???????? ????????;
# ????????????? ???????? ????? ??????;
# ??????? Activity ?? ?????;
# ????????????? ??? Activity ? ActionBar;
# ?????? ?????? action_previous ? ????? ???? ActionBar.
self.start_screen.screen_manager.add_widget(screen)
self.start_screen.screen_manager.transition = FadeTransition()
self.start_screen.screen_manager.current = string_new_name_screen
self.start_screen.action_previous.title = string_new_name_screen
self.start_screen.action_previous.app_icon = \
"Data/Images/arrow_left.png"
评论列表
文章目录